What Happens When Workers’ Comp Falls Short in Warren City

While workers’ compensation is designed to address many injuries, it often isn’t enough to provide complete recovery, especially if your injury leads to long-term disability or affects your ability to work in your chosen profession. What many people don’t realize is that they may also have the option to file a separate legal action in addition to their workers’ comp claim.

A third-party claim can be pursued if your injury was caused by someone other than your employer, such as:

A subcontractor or vendor on a shared worksite
A negligent property owner or general contractor
A manufacturer of faulty equipment or tools
A careless driver who caused an accident while you were on the job

Injuries on Construction Sites in Warren City

Construction zones are some of the most high-risk workplaces in Warren City. With powerful tools, dangerous substances, and elevated workspaces, the risk of life-altering accidents is ever-present. In fact, the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) reports that a fifth of worker deaths are reported in the construction industry. The leading causes — known as the “Fatal Four” — are slips and falls, being struck by objects, exposure to electrical hazards, and caught-in/between accidents.
These injuries often involve multiple parties — including site managers, property owners, and third-party contractors — and require a seasoned legal team to sort through the liability.

The Role of Medical Documentation in Proving Your Claim

Medical documentation is the cornerstone of any valid work injury claim. Detailed records not only prove the impact of your injuries but also create a direct connection between the workplace incident and your injury diagnosis. Essential medical documents include:
Initial Medical Reports

Immediate assessments post-injury.

Diagnostic Test Results

X-rays, MRIs, and other relevant tests.

Treatment Records

Documentation of ongoing treatments and therapies.

Physician Statements

Professional opinions on your injury's impact on your work capabilities.

Ensuring that all medical evidence is comprehensive and accurately reflects your condition can significantly bolster your claim.
